nvme-wdc-namespace-resize - Man Page

Resizes the device's namespace.

Synopsis

nvme wdc namespace-resize <device> [--nsid=<NAMSPACE ID>, -n <NAMSPACE ID>] [--op_option=<OP OPTION>, -o <OP OPTION>]

Description

For the NVMe device given, sends the WDC Vendor Specific Command that modifies the namespace size reported by the device.

The <device> parameter is mandatory NVMe character device (ex: /dev/nvme0).

This will only work on WDC devices supporting this feature. Results for any other device are undefined.

Options

-n <NAMSPACE ID>, --namespace-id=<NAMSPACE_ID>

Namespace ID; ID of the namespace to resize

-o <OP OPTION>, --op-option=<OP OPTION>

Overprovisioning Option; defaults to 0xF

Valid Values:
0x1 - 7% of Original TNVMCAP reported value
0x2 - 28% of Original TNVMCAP reported value
0x3 - 50% of Original TNVMCAP reported value
0xF - 0% of Original TNVMCAP reported value (original config)
All other values - reserved
